In traditional construction practices, wall studs are generally available in either 2 inches by 4 inches (2×4) or 2 inches by 6 inches (2×6) in width. The common width for a wall stud is 3.5 inches (89mm), which coincides with the nominal width of a 2×4. It’s called a 2×4 because the lumber is approximately 2 inches by 4 inches before it’s trimmed down to its finished size of 1.5 inches by 3.5 inches. The standard stud spacing is usually 16 inches (40.64 cm) or 24 inches (60.96 cm), but this can vary depending on your project needs.
